21xrx.com
2024-11-10 07:37:28 Sunday
登录
文章检索 我的文章 写文章
C++编译器
2023-06-25 02:36:10 深夜i     --     --
C++语言 编译器 源代码 构建 错误信息

C++是一种面向对象的编程语言,许多程序员喜欢使用它来编写高效、强大的应用程序和系统。为了将C++代码转换为可执行的计算机程序,需要使用C++编译器。

C++编译器是一种程序,它可以将C++代码转换为计算机可以理解的二进制指令。C++编译器可以执行多个功能,如识别语法错误、将源代码转换为二进制代码、优化程序性能并生成可执行文件。

C++编译器经常与集成开发环境(IDE)一起使用。IDE包括一个文本编辑器、调试器和编译器,使程序员能够在同一界面中编写、调试和运行代码。IDE中的编译器还提供了额外的调试功能,如跟踪变量、执行代码行和检测内存泄漏。

在使用C++编译器时,有几个重要的概念需要了解。首先是源代码。源代码是程序员编写的C++代码。其次是目标代码。目标代码是编译器生成的未完整链接和优化的代码。最后是可执行文件。可执行文件是经过链接和优化的代码,可以直接在计算机上运行。

在使用C++编译器时,需要了解一些编译器选项。编译器选项是定义编译器将如何处理源代码的命令行参数。例如,参数-O可以启用编译器的优化功能。通过选项-d,可以生成调试信息,便于程序员进行调试。

C++编译器同样可以应用到许多领域,如嵌入式系统中、操作系统内核和游戏开发。编译器的性能和功能对于应用程序的高效运行至关重要,因此程序员需要了解和应用优秀的编译器。

总的来说,C++编译器是一个非常重要的工具,它为程序员提供了将源代码转换为可执行程序的能力。了解编译器选项和性能将有助于程序员编写出高效、强大的应用程序和系统。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复